I'm really looking forward to this. I've been to Yellowstone in the winter and I suggest you do the same. It's remarkable and well worth the effort. To get the days you want, you'll need to contact the vendor. Bookings are generally made 1 year in advance and a reservation with cancelation insurance can be made for as little as $150.00. Look for a package deal. I saved $125.00 on the room, and was given free food.
Anyone planning a vacation at anytimeshould find the rental car 1st. Not only can you find the lowest price "now", if you don't, a weekly check of the car company(s), you will eventually find the lower price and feel good about saving a few bucks.
